C#
凌冰_
分享知识带给我的快乐!帮助他人就是帮助自己。
希望更多人能关注,来分享我的成果!
希望大家快快乐乐的学习,开开心心的畅游知识的海洋。
展开
-
C# 格式字符串的格式项
一、如何输出货币格式,小数保留位数?语法:{ 索引[,对齐][:格式字符串]}说明:索引:从0开始,与变量列表对应 对齐:设置显示的宽度和对齐的方式 格式字符串: 包含格式说明符 一个带符号的整数,整数的大小表示数据的宽度,正数为右对齐,负数为左对齐如下: Console.WriteLine("{0原创 2015-12-31 16:26:27 · 653 阅读 · 0 评论 -
C# Convert.ToInt32()与int.Parse()的区别
(1)这两个方法的最大不同是它们对null值的处理方法: Convert.ToInt32(null)会返回0而不会产生任何异常,但int.Parse(null)则会产生异常。(2)它们的区别是: (A). Convert.ToInt32(double value)如果 value 为两个整数中间的数字,则返回二者中的偶数;即 3.5转换为4; 4原创 2016-04-21 09:45:44 · 390 阅读 · 0 评论 -
C# DataView数据筛选与排序
一、 直接在已有数据中筛选;不必重新检索数据 (1)查询两张表的数据 /// /// 加载所有的数据 /// private void FillDataStudent() { //sql语句 sql = new StringBuilder();原创 2016-03-09 15:19:32 · 2239 阅读 · 0 评论 -
C# 在第二个窗体上添加数据之后如何刷新第一个窗体加载的数据
如何在第二个窗体上添加数据之后,刷新第一个窗体的数据? 解决: (1)在第二个窗体上添加第一个窗体的引用 private Form1 frm; public Form2(Form1 frm) { this.frm = f原创 2016-03-19 12:07:13 · 4060 阅读 · 1 评论 -
C# 第一个窗体的数据传递到第二个窗体上应用
如何将第一个窗体的数据传递到第二个窗体上应用? 解决:(1)在第二个窗体上定义一个变量,public string name; (2)在第一个窗体上给刚才定义的变量赋值: Form2 frm = new Form2(); frm.name="具体的值";原创 2016-03-19 11:59:02 · 2872 阅读 · 0 评论 -
C# 关闭当前窗体开启一个新的窗体
登录窗体登录成功后显示主窗体,必须要关闭当前窗体。否则就会出现两个窗体哦! 如何解决这个问题? (1)登录窗体的代码如下: //标记是否登录成功 bool flags = false; public bool Flags { get { return flags; }原创 2016-03-19 11:51:07 · 1558 阅读 · 0 评论 -
C# 值传递与引用传递的区别
一、传递值类型参数1、通过值传递值类型当实参当作值来传递时,就产生的一个副本,也就是值不发生变化。class MyTest { static void Main(string[] args) { int number=10; ModifyValue(number);原创 2015-12-22 11:54:02 · 1329 阅读 · 0 评论 -
C#循环while、do...while、for、foreach
一、循环结构 1) while语法: 2) do..while语法: 3) for语法: 4) foreach语法: 二、总结: 1:语法 2:执行顺序(1)while 循环:先判断,再执行(2)do-whi原创 2015-12-19 11:30:45 · 760 阅读 · 0 评论 -
C#修饰符、字段、属性
一、字段二、属性三、如何使用属性四、总结原创 2015-12-22 09:29:23 · 870 阅读 · 0 评论 -
C# 连接数据库(添加,修改,删除)
一、添加年级信息到表中 /// /// 添加年级表 /// INSERT INTO grade VALUES('IT11') /// private static void addGrade(string gname) { SqlConnection con = null;原创 2016-01-22 16:03:32 · 977 阅读 · 0 评论 -
C# 用OO来实现超市的购买结账
一、如图所示: 二、具体步骤: 1) 商品类(商品ID,商品Name,商品Price)class Goods { //商品编号 private int id; public int Id { get { return id; } set { id = v原创 2016-01-05 11:17:16 · 1963 阅读 · 0 评论 -
C# 选择结构 if、if..else、if..elseif...else、switch
一、选择结构 .if语法: Console.WriteLine("输入考试成绩: "); //提示输入成绩 int score = int.Parse(Console.ReadLine()); if ( score > 95 ) { //判断是否大于95分原创 2015-12-19 10:13:22 · 1120 阅读 · 0 评论 -
C#连接MSSQL数据库
一、ADO.NET的主要组件 二、ADO.NET结构图 三、Connection连接对象的属性及方法 四、Command连接对象的属性及方法 五、如何建立数据库连接 六、如何获得连接字符串 七、实现登陆操作 private static void Login() {原创 2016-01-19 16:49:48 · 2823 阅读 · 0 评论 -
第一章 初始C#
一、.NET与C#概述 C#是一个语言,.net是一个平台;C#不但可以开发基于.net的应用程序,也可以开发基于WinForm的程序。 C#是事件驱动的,完全面向对象的可视化编程语言,我们可以使用集成开发环境来编写C#程序。使用IDE,程序员可以方便的建立,运行,测试和调试C#程序,这就将开发一个可用程序的时间减少到不用IDE开发时所用时间的一小部分。使用ID原创 2015-12-17 12:16:51 · 493 阅读 · 0 评论 -
C# String类常用的方法的使用
一、string类常用方法 1) IndexOf():查找某个字符在字符串中的位置; 如果没有,则返回-1;返回的第一次出现的位置 Console.Write("请输入你的邮箱:"); string email = Console.ReadLine(); // 电子邮件地址 Conso原创 2015-12-31 15:53:20 · 451 阅读 · 0 评论 -
C# vs2012 无法添加数据库连接 Microsoft.SqlServer.Management.Sdk.Sfc
添加数据连接时发生异常:解决:下载了Microsoft SQL Server 2012的补丁SQLSysClrTypes.msi和SharedManagementObjects.msi。地址:https://www.microsoft.com/zh-cn/download/details.aspx?id=43339对应的x86的版本哦!下载完毕后,再按照...原创 2019-04-08 10:57:08 · 2448 阅读 · 5 评论